轻松学习MySQL,图文并茂下载攻略必备(mysql下载示图)

轻松学习MySQL,图文并茂下载攻略必备

MySQL是一种开放源代码的关系型数据库管理系统,广泛应用于Web应用程序的后台数据管理。对于想要学习MySQL的初学者来说,掌握其基础知识是必不可少的。在本文中,我们将提供一些简单易懂的步骤和指南,让您轻松学习MySQL,同时有效地管理数据和提高数据查询效率。

一、环境搭建

在学习MySQL之前,您需要先准备好该软件的环境。MySQL支持多种操作系统和平台,可以在Windows、Linux、Mac OS X等系统下使用。同时,MySQL还支持多种语言接口,包括C、Java、Perl、Python等等。此处我们以安装MySQL 5.7 版本为例,介绍MySQL在Windows系统下的安装步骤。

1.下载MySQL 5.7安装程序

在MySQL官网(https://dev.mysql.com/downloads/mysql/)上下载MySQL 5.7的安装程序。下载完成后,将压缩包解压到一个目录,例如:C:\MySQL。

2.初始化MySQL

打开CMD控制台,进入C:\MySQL\bin目录,输入以下命令行:

mysql.exe -u root -p

回车后,输入密码,此时显示mysql>表示您已成功进入MySQL命令行模式。

3.设置MySQL账号密码

进入MySQL命令行模式后,您需要设置MySQL的账号密码。输入以下命令,创建一个名为newuser的用户:

CREATE USER ‘newuser’@’localhost’ IDENTIFIED BY ‘password’;

其中,newuser为新用户的用户名,password为新用户的密码。

4.授权用户

执行以下命令,授权用户newuser可以在任何数据库中进行操作:

GRANT ALL PRIVILEGES ON *.* TO ‘newuser’@’localhost’ WITH GRANT OPTION;

5.退出MySQL

执行以下命令,退出MySQL命令行模式:

quit;

二、数据库管理

1.创建数据库

在MySQL中,可以使用CREATE DATABASE语句来创建新数据库。例如:

CREATE DATABASE mydatabase;

其中,mydatabase为您要创建的数据库名称。

2.删除数据库

使用DROP DATABASE语句可以删除已经存在的数据库。例如:

DROP DATABASE mydatabase;

其中,mydatabase为您要删除的数据库名称。

3.创建数据表

使用CREATE TABLE语句可以创建新的数据表。例如:

CREATE TABLE mytable (

id INT NOT NULL AUTO_INCREMENT,

name VARCHAR(50) NOT NULL,

PRIMARY KEY (id)

);

这个示例中,我们创建了一个名为mytable的表格,包含了id和name两个字段。

4.删除数据表

使用DROP TABLE语句可以删除已存在的数据表格。例如:

DROP TABLE mytable;

其中,mytable为您要删除的数据表格名称。

三、数据查询

1.查询数据

使用SELECT语句可以查询数据表中的数据。例如:

SELECT * FROM mytable;

其中,mytable为您要查询数据的数据表格名称。

2.插入数据

使用INSERT语句可以向数据表中插入新的数据。例如:

INSERT INTO mytable (name) VALUES (‘John’);

其中,mytable为您要插入数据的数据表格名称,name为该数据表格中的字段名,John为要插入的数据。

3.更新数据

使用UPDATE语句可以更新数据表格中的数据。例如:

UPDATE mytable SET name=’Jack’ WHERE id=1;

其中,mytable为您要更新数据的数据表格名称,name为该数据表格中的字段名,’Jack’为要更新成的新数据。

4.删除数据

使用DELETE语句可以删除数据表中的数据。例如:

DELETE FROM mytable WHERE id=1;

其中,mytable为您要删除数据的数据表格名称。

通过以上简单的步骤和指南,您可以轻松学习MySQL的基本概念和使用方法。此外,还可以通过下载各种教程资料和学习资源,加强对MySQL的掌握。尽可能多的实践习题,是成为MySQL专家的必经之路。

代码示例:

1.创建数据库

CREATE DATABASE mydatabase;

2.删除数据库

DROP DATABASE mydatabase;

3.创建数据表

CREATE TABLE mytable (

id INT NOT NULL AUTO_INCREMENT,

name VARCHAR(50) NOT NULL,

PRIMARY KEY (id)

);

4.删除数据表

DROP TABLE mytable;

5.查询数据

SELECT * FROM mytable;

6.插入数据

INSERT INTO mytable (name) VALUES (‘John’);

7.更新数据

UPDATE mytable SET name=’Jack’ WHERE id=1;

8.删除数据

DELETE FROM mytable WHERE id=1;


数据运维技术 » 轻松学习MySQL,图文并茂下载攻略必备(mysql下载示图)